WebThe duty of confidentiality is based on four major arguments: The principle of respect for autonomy or respect for persons. Respect for autonomy, or respect for persons, calls for us to allow others to decide who they want to know certain details about themselves. WebConfidentiality is an important component of privacy legislation and a cornerstone of a medical professional's fiduciary obligations. Patients share some of their most sensitive personal information with their physicians and physicians, in turn, have an obligation to ensure the information entrusted to them is kept secure and confidential. ...
